Are you looking for a guide to Linux Penetration Testing? Trying to stay on top of the latest security defense strategies? If you’re looking to become a cybersecurity expert, this is the perfect starting point. Linux Penetration Testing is a method of utilizing tools and techniques to evaluate the security of systems and networks running on Linux operating systems. Penetration testing is a crucial first step to protect your systems and data as it identifies any vulnerabilities and potential threats. It is a comprehensive approach to simulate a malicious attack on your systems for accurate assessment, highlights security loopholes and suggests solutions for improved security measures.
1. Understanding Linux Penetration Testing
Linux Penetration Testing Basics
Penetration testing on Linux systems is a process of evaluating the security of the system by proactively attempting to breach it. It is used to detect vulnerabilities within the system, which could lead to potential security threats and compromise the system. In Linux penetration testing, the tester simulates an attack on the system to perform vulnerability assessment.
The process of Linux penetration testing involves gathering information on the target system, spotting weaknesses and possible exploits, and then exploiting the openings. It is important to think like a hacker in order to find the most likely security loopholes. Here are some of the tasks which are typically involved in Linux penetration testing:
- Gathering information
- Identifying vulnerabilities
- Testing for exploits
- Exploiting system weaknesses
The end result of a successful Linux penetration testing exercise is an increased security posture for the system. By exploiting potential security risks an organization can protect itself against the threats and prevent future security breaches. With the ever-evolving threat landscape, it is important for organizations to continuously test and strengthen their systems.
2. Gaining the Knowledge and Skills Needed for Linux Penetration Testing
Linux penetration testing requires knowledge and a variety of skills to accomplish the task. To increase your success rate, arm yourself with a few pieces of key information.
- Understand the different components of the Linux platform and systems, as well as the internals of the operating systems.
- Learn the best practices for conducting a full reconnaissance of potential targets before testing.
- Explore the tools and techniques to conduct manual and automated security assessments.
Gaining the skills needed for penetration testing also requires an understanding of the tools and processes used to detect vulnerabilities. Once you have that understanding, you can hone your skills further by running simulated exercises to implement your knowledge. Additionally, you should have the ability to interpret the output of the security assessments so you can make decisions about how to mitigate any risks. Finally, network with other penetration testers to stay abreast of the latest trends and technologies.
3. Utilizing Linux Penetration Testing Tools
Penetration testing is a crucial component of any IT security risk assessment and for organisations who rely on their IT systems to remain secure and compliant. Linux is a versatile platform for assessing vulnerabilities and performing penetration testing due to its extensive library of innovative and powerful tools. Here are some of the most popular Linux penetration testing tools:
- Metasploit Framework: It is an open-source platform to exploit a variety of security issues, allowing users to launch and customize attacks on web servers, networks, and other systems.
- Nmap: One of the most popular and comprehensive security scanners for network exploration and testing. It can be used to detect open ports, live hosts, operating systems, services and much more.
- John the Ripper: A renowned tool for detecting weak passwords and testing password strength. The tool can also crack various encryption passwords including MD5, Unix and SHA hashes.
These are just a few of the many Linux penetration testing tools available for system admins and penetration testers alike. Utilising these tools properly can help organisations stay secure and prevent malicious actors from hijacking their networks. Security personnel need to be aware of the potential security issues associated with these tools and take measures to protect themselves from any potential harm.
4. Staying Up-to-Date with the Latest Developments in Linux Penetration Testing
As a Linux penetration tester, it is important to stay up-to-date with the latest developments and techniques in the field. Here are some ways to make sure your skills are up-to-date.
- Subscribe to relevant blogs: Many blogs are dedicated to exploring the ins and outs of Linux penetration testing. Subscribe to a few and make sure you check in often to stay on top of the latest trends.
- Attend conferences and meetups: Conferences and meetups are a great way to get connected with other Linux penetration testers and learn more about the field. Take advantage of these opportunities to hear from the experts and expand your understanding.
- Stay abreast of the news: In the tech field, news travels fast. Keep an eye on industry news outlets and blogs to get the latest updates in the world of Linux penetration testing.
For the ultimate Linux penetration testing experience, get involved in the community. Participate in discussion forums and each other’s work. Doing so will help you gain valuable feedback and tips to master your skills.
Q&A
Q: What is Linux Penetration Testing?
A: Linux Penetration Testing is when security experts use special tools to try and find vulnerabilities in a Linux system. It’s done to make sure data and systems are safe from attackers.
Q: What does a Penetration Tester do?
A: A Penetration Tester examines a Linux system for security weaknesses. They look for gaps in the system which could be used by malicious hackers to gain access or cause disruption.
Q: How can Penetration Testing help protect my data?
A: Penetration Testing can help keep your data safe by making sure any security gaps are identified and fixed before an attacker can strike. It also helps you prepare for potential attacks in the future. The best way to stay safe when testing Linux is to create a FREE LogMeOnce account that includes Auto-login and Single Sign-On to protect your data. With accurate security features to guard against Linux Penetration Testing, you can finally ensure safe and secure data on your system. So don’t wait, visit LogMeOnce.com today and protect yourself!
Nicole’s, journey in the tech industry is marked by a passion for learning and an unwavering commitment to excellence. Whether it’s delving into the latest software developments or exploring innovative computing solutions, Nicole’s expertise is evident in her insightful and informative writing style. Her ability to connect with readers through her words makes her a valuable asset in any technical communication endeavor.